8 changes: 5 additions & 3 deletions website/content/api-docs/secret/ssh.mdx
Expand Up @@ -132,9 +132,11 @@ This endpoint creates or updates a named role.
then this list enforces it. If this field is set, then credentials can only
be created for `default_user` and usernames present in this list. Setting
this option will enable all the users with access this role to fetch
credentials for all other usernames in this list. Use with caution. N.B.: if
the type is `ca`, an empty list does not allow any user; instead you must use
`*` to enable this behavior.
credentials for all other usernames in this list.

When `allowed_users_template` is set to `true`, this field can contain an identity
template with any prefix or suffix, like `ssh-{{identity.entity.id}}-user`.
Use with caution. N.B.: if the type is `ca`, an empty list does not allow any user;
instead you must use `*` to enable this behavior.

- `allowed_users_template` `(bool: false)` - If set, allowed_users can be specified
using identity template policies. Non-templated users are also permitted.
